Former bank and children's home among commercial lots up for grabs at auction

A former bank is among a cast of commercial properties which are due to go under the hammer next month.

The former RBS building in the centre of Newcastle-under-Lyme, in Staffordshire, will be up for grabs at the Bond Wolfe Auction sale at Villa Park, in Birmingham, on July 3.

The freehold property in the High Street occupies a prominent town centre location and is considered suitable for a variety of uses, subject to planning permission, and has a guide price of more than £285,000.

Elsewhere in the West Midlands, a town centre office building in Lichfield Street, Walsall, is up for grabs for more than £170,000.

The building is a period three storey mid-terraced property with single and two storey extensions at the rear.

Further south in Malvern, there is a town centre commercial investment opportunity in Church Street in the region of £235,000.

The building boasts a ground floor retail unit – which is currently occupied by the Shaw Trust on a 10-year lease until 2022 – while the upper two floors are home to office accommodation with planning permission for conversion to an apartment.

Other lots on the day include:

  • An office and retail investment in High Street, Knowle, near Solihul
  • A city centre property in Victoria Street, Wolverhampton, which is currently a restaurant
  • Viscount House - a former children’s home in Castle Vale, Birmingham.

Next month’s auction will be Bond Wolfe Auctions’ third auction of the year. It starts at 10.30am in the Holte Suite of Aston Villa FC.
